Abstract

The utility model relates to a novel oral cavity vibration washing negative pressure cleaning device which comprises a brush handle and a brush head, wherein the brush head comprises a cleaning head and a connecting pipe, the cleaning head is fixedly connected with one end of the connecting pipe, the other end of the connecting pipe is detachably connected with the top end of the brush handle, the upper surface of the cleaning head is provided with bristles, a cavity is arranged in the cleaning head, a partition plate is transversely arranged in the cavity and divides the cavity into a first cavity and a second cavity which are mutually independent, the upper surface of the cleaning head is provided with a water outlet, the lower surface of the cleaning head is provided with a liquid suction port, the water outlet is communicated with the first cavity, the liquid suction port is communicated with the second cavity, and one end, close to the connecting pipe, of the cleaning head is provided with a water inlet pipe and a water return pipe. The utility model adopts the disposable brush head, the brush handle part can be reused, the risk of cross infection can be reduced, and the cost can be reduced; the combination of the pressurized flushing and the negative pressure suction device can deeply clean the whole oral cavity, reduce the risk of the patient of choking and cough and avoid secondary pollution.

Novel negative pressure cleaning device for mouth cavity vibration washing
Technical Field
The utility model relates to the technical field of medical instruments, in particular to a novel oral cavity vibration washing negative pressure cleaning device.
Background
At present, after the guardianship room patient bedridden for a long time, daily oral cavity cleaning nursing is target in place inadequately, thereby it infects to lead to oral cavity bacterium colony imbalance to take place easily, general hospital can use tweezers to press from both sides the cotton ball, it carries out oral care for patient to dip in the nursing liquid, this kind of nursing method operation is inconvenient, patient's comfort level is relatively poor, patient's oral cavity cleaning nursing often is not in place, perhaps clear up through the toothbrush, it is difficult to carry out degree of depth cleanness and nursing to the whole microenvironment in oral cavity, and patient's oral cavity washing fluid is difficult for discharging, spill over easily and cause secondary pollution, a large amount of washing fluids flow down along with the larynx, still can cause stupor or unconscious patient to chock to cough and inhale by mistake.
Devices for negative pressure suction oral tooth cleaning also exist in the prior art, but generally such devices are recycled, causing cross-contamination of bacterial colonies in the patient's mouth, which results in a higher risk of infection. The novel oral cavity vibration washing negative pressure cleaning device provided by the embodiment of the utility model has the implementation principle that: the hair-shaped surface of the brush head 2 is provided with a water outlet 12 which is connected with a one-way pressurizable flushing device through a built-in water inlet pipe 14; the back of the brush head 2 is provided with a liquid suction port 13 which is connected with a negative pressure suction device through a built-in water return pipe 15. When the device is operated, an operator installs a new brush head 2, connects a corresponding device, closes the negative pressure suction device, opens the pressurizing flushing device, then presses the switch 101, the hairy surface of the brush head 2 sprays sterile water or disinfectant to the oral cavity of a patient through pressurization, the brush head 2 is driven to vibrate through the vibration of the electric motor 102, and the operator can clean the surfaces and gaps of the teeth, gingiva and periodontal of the patient; after brushing, close pressurization washing unit, open negative pressure suction device, the negative pressure suction device at the 2 backs of brush head continues to carry out negative pressure suction to the residual liquid after washing in the oral cavity through imbibition mouth 13, the waste liquid gets into second cavity 11, filter the particulate matter in the washing liquid waste water of retrieving from patient's mouth through filter screen 3, prevent that the particulate matter from getting into the negative pressure machine, cause the negative pressure machine to block up, reduce the cost of later stage machine fault maintenance, prevent simultaneously that a large amount of flush fluids from flowing down along the larynx, the patient that causes stupor or consciousness chocks to cough and inhales by mistake.
